7 Skills New Marketers Need To Succeed [Infographic]

Digital marketers are becoming Jacks-of-all-trades. Not only must successful marketers be social media mavens and create great content, they also must know how to newsjack, analyze data and of course, work in a stressful environment collaboratively with team members. The below infographic, courtesy of Formstack, outlines seven skills new marketers need to succeed.

What People Share On Social Networks [Infographic]

Billions of people worldwide tap into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n and even Pinterest to share photos (43%), opinions (26%), status updates (26%), links to articles (26%) and personal recommendations of things they like. This infographic, courtesy of GO-Gulf, dives deep into the behaviors and preferences of social media users.
